State Street Corporation, established in 1792 and headquartered in Boston, Massachusetts, is one of the oldest financial institutions in the United States and a major player in the global asset management and custody banking sectors. Primarily known for its custodial services, it safeguards assets for institutional investors, managing trillions of dollars through its State Street Global Advisors (SSGA) division, which is renowned for launching the first U.S. exchange-traded fund (ETF), the SPDR S&P 500 ETF (SPY), in 1993. The company provides a range of services including investment management, research, trading, and data analytics, catering mostly to institutional clients like pension funds, endowments, and mutual funds. With a focus on financial infrastructure and innovation, State Street has positioned itself as a key backbone in the global investment ecosystem.

State Street's Q4 2020 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2020, State Street held 3,966 positions worth $1.63T, up 12% from $1.46T the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 21% of the portfolio.

State Street's Q4 2020 filing shows 129 new, 1,854 increased, 1,669 reduced and 80 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Apartment Income REIT Corp.: 6,493,036 shares worth $249M. The largest sale was Apple, an estimated $4.12B.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 22% of assets, down from 22%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Financials.
